首页 > 代码库 > 6月2日
6月2日
检查不同平均距离计算方法的结果
1.所有点对距离的调和平均
2.每个点与其他点最短距离的算术平均
总半径 = 5622.2026
没有明显变化。用第二种方法似乎布局反而更稀疏。
3. 采用2的方案,再把sparseFactor从0.2改为1.0
总的坐标范围反而变小,总半径 = 3889.0559
按道理, avgDist * scaleRate = 2 * avgSize * m_sparseFactor
sparseFactor越大,开始后处理时点越稀疏
此时qt creator 的截图如上,项目之间比较密集了,但是又有点难以分清,项目之间存在相交。
4.再把sparseFactor改为2.0
总半径 = 14813.535,范围变大
估计是由于一些底层元素体积膨胀所致
4.再把sparseFactor改为5.0
总半径 = 375191.00,范围变大,与前一结果基本成比例,说明项目之间比较稀疏,基本没有碰撞
5. debug 与release布局不一样???
debug
release
结果基本一样
6.改良项目半径的度量,改为包围盒半径
sparsefactor为1时,使用包围盒半长边半径度量
total radius: 3770.042480
使用包围盒对角线半径度量
total radius: 11391.824219
使用对角线的qt creator 布局,两者差别不大。
对角线半径度量范围更大,半长边半径度量更加紧凑。
来自为知笔记(Wiz)
6月2日
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。